About Nexxen

501-1,000 employees

Nexxen builds programmatic advertising technology—a DSP, SSP, and data platform—used by brands, agencies, and publishers to plan, buy, and monetize TV/CTV and digital video. The public company earns media-buying and platform fees and operates across North America, Europe, and APAC. Headquartered in New York, it is listed in London and focuses on data-driven campaigns across converged media.
